Job Specifics
Duties Description This position will support the Public Transportation Bureau (PTB). The Office Assistant 2 (calc) will provide general and administrative support to ensure efficient operation of the bureau. This position will play a vital role in supporting staff, maintaining organized records, managing communications, and assisting with routine operational tasks. Under the direct supervision of the Director of the Public Transportation Bureau, the selected candidate will work independently and may also receive assignments from the Deputy Director and three Section Heads (Service and Oversight; Financial Support; and Strategy and Development Sections). Duties and responsibilities include, but are not limited to:
• Greet and assist visitors, answer phones, and direct inquiries appropriately;
• Maintain and organize physical and electronic filing systems;
• Prepare and distribute routine correspondence and documents;
• Schedule meetings and take notes, manage calendars, and coordinate logistics for events;
• Monitor and order office supplies; maintain inventory and supply rooms;
• Sort and distribute incoming mail and prepare outgoing mail/packages;
• Support data entry, database updates, and report preparation;
• Obtain appropriate approvals for staff approved travel; assist with reconciling travel expense reports through the Statewide Financial System (SFS);
• Assist with coordination of employee training, awards, and accomplishments;
• Photocopying, scanning, and compiling reports/packets as needed;
• Assist with onboarding new staff, including preparing materials and coordinating logistics;
• Assist and coordinate responses to Freedom of Information Law (FOIL) requests;
• Maintain confidentiality and ensure compliance with office policies and procedures;
• Other related duties, as assigned.
Responsibilities may include serving a role within the Incident Command System to support the department’s response to regional and statewide emergency situations.

Additional Comments *This title is part of the New York Hiring for Emergency Limited Placement Statewide Program (NY HELPS). For the duration of the NY HELPS Program, this title may be filled via a non-competitive appointment, which means no examination is required but all candidates must meet the minimum qualifications of the title for which they apply.
At a future date (within one year of permanent appointment), it is expected employees hired under NY HELPS will have their non-competitive employment status converted to competitive status, without having to compete in an examination. Employees will then be afforded with all of the same rights and privileges of competitive class employees of New York State. While serving permanently in a NY HELPS title, employees may take part in any promotion examination for which they are qualified.
